WebBelow are all of the verses I could find in the Gospels that show Jesus praying. ( Lk 3:21-22) At His Baptism. ( Mk 1:35-36) In the morning before heading to Galilee. ( Lk 5:16) After healing people. ( Lk 6:12-13) Praying all night before choosing His 12 disciples. Jesus called Himself the “Son of man” 79 times in the Gospels. Web13 jul. 2024 · Jesus is shown to be praying at least thirty-eight times in the Gospels. How many times did Jesus pray in Luke? The parallel in Mark has Jesus praying only once but in Luke 5:16 it was Jesus’ custom. Jesus spent all night on the hills in prayer before He chose the Twelve (6:12-16).
